Ticket: duplicate customer records resurfacing after merge in the Pellworth CRM. Support has reported that merged accounts reappear as separate entries within 24 hours, apparently because the nightly sync from the Ordano billing feed re-creates the retired record. The dedupe service correctly tombstones the loser record, but the sync job does not honor tombstones. Until the fix lands, advise customers that duplicates are cosmetic and billing is unaffected. The fix has been merged and is included in the build identified below.

build token for bahip-fawif: htk3_6a1

Dispatcher creds for the Rostrum driver-assignment heuristic expired at 02:00 last night. Assignment scoring fell back to round-robin; ETAs degraded fleet-wide in the Marbury region. Root cause: the heuristic service's token to the telemetry feed lapsed before the rotation job ran. Fix is merged on branch hotfix-rostrum-auth; needs inclusion in tonight's cut. Blocking release 4.12 until verified. Config change only, no schema impact. Deploy with the rotated credential issued this morning, shown below.

gateway credential: kto23_LX9A4ys6i4nzHtpOLNLodKK

## Kiosk Watchdog & Sessions

The Lumistand kiosk runs a watchdog that kills any session idle past 90 seconds and wipes the local cache — handy when shoppers wander off mid-checkout. Restarts re-auth against the session broker automatically. If you're poking at the watchdog endpoints during review, authenticate with the bearer token below.

portal login ticket: eyJhbGciOiJIUzI1NiIsInR5cCI6IkpXVCJ9.eyJzdWIiOiIwEOsktwVNwIn0.-UJU3fdyyCgG